SpaceX’s Starship Prototype Achieves Record-Breaking Flight Before Crashing Due to Engine Failure – ENGINEERING.com
The SN8’s engine shut off during its descent, causing it to freefall rapidly.

SpaceX’s Starship prototype rocket achieved a record-breaking launch height on its test flight on December 9 in the South Texas village of Boca Chica. The SN8 (being the eighth Starship prototype) managed to reach 12.5 kilometers in 6 minutes and 42 seconds before crashing during its landing attempt.
